Foundation Stabilizing in Tampa, FL
Foundation stabilizing services involve procedures designed to reinforce and secure the stability of a building’s foundation. This type of work is commonly requested for homes experiencing uneven floors, cracks in walls or ceilings, or signs of shifting and settling. Projects may include underpinning, piering, or installing supports to counteract soil movement or moisture issues that can cause foundation movement. Homeowners typically want to understand the methods used, the scope of work required, and how the stabilization will address existing structural concerns to ensure the safety and longevity of their property.
Before requesting foundation stabilizing services, property owners often seek clarity on the specific signs indicating foundation issues, such as visible cracks or doors that don’t close properly. It’s also important to consider the extent of the stabilization needed and how it might affect other parts of the property during the process. Understanding the potential causes of foundation movement, such as soil conditions or drainage problems, can help homeowners make informed decisions about the necessary repairs and long-term maintenance to preserve their home’s structural integrity.

Common Foundation Stabilizing Jobs
Foundation Stabilizing - Reinforces and stabilizes compromised foundation structures to prevent further shifting.
Pier and Beam Repair - Corrects uneven or sinking piers to restore property stability.
Mudjacking and Slab Lifting - Elevates sunken concrete slabs to improve safety and appearance.
Underpinning Services - Strengthens weak foundation areas to support the entire structure.
Crack Repair - Seals and stabilizes foundation cracks to prevent water intrusion and damage.
Soil Stabilization - Improves soil conditions around the foundation to reduce shifting risks.
Foundation Stabilizing Questions
What is foundation stabilizing? It involves techniques to strengthen and support a building’s foundation to prevent or repair settling and shifting issues.
What signs indicate foundation problems? Common signs include cracks in walls or floors, uneven flooring, and sticking doors or windows.
What types of projects require foundation stabilization? Projects often include addressing foundation settlement, shifting, or damage caused by soil movement or moisture changes.
How does foundation stabilizing benefit property owners? It helps maintain structural integrity, prevents further damage, and preserves the value of the property.
